Last Chance for Club Number Plates

PCWAPlate.JPG

We have been advised by the Department of Transport that due to low volumes, our Club Plates will be withdrawn and retired on the 12th October 2010.

There is now a requirement that these types of plate series meet a minimum sales requirement of ten sets per annum.

Members who have already bought a number plate in the Club Series, will continue to be able to apply for remakes. New plates will no longer be available.

So, if you want a Club Plate please let me know on jaychlo@q-net.net.au before the retirement date above.

General numbers such as birthdays etc are available for $325. There are some "Porsche" numbers still left, and these carry a small premium above the standard rate. (They are still cheaper than most customised plates)

Members can only choose the three numbers on the plate. The letters and Club logo remain the same on all plates.
